Abstract
► Evaluation of liver, kidney and placenta porphobilinogen-synthase activity as a Hg marker exposure in pregnant and fetuses. ► Renal parameters were evaluated in pregnant rats exposed to different doses of HgCl2 in drinking water. ► HgCl2 exhibited an increase on hepatic porphobilinogen-synthase from fetuses. ► Pregnant rats presented an increase in relative renal weight but none alterations in serum urea and creatinine levels. ► Pregnant rats demonstrated a decrease in body weight and in total food intake.
